Pier 62 is a captivating urban park located on the picturesque Seattle Waterfront, offering a refreshing escape right in the heart of the city. This beautifully designed park stretches along the waterfront, boasting panoramic views of Elliott Bay and the majestic Olympic Mountains. With its lush green spaces, walking paths, and areas dedicated to relaxation, Pier 62 is a perfect destination for tourists seeking to enjoy Seattle's natural beauty while being close to urban amenities. Whether you’re looking to take a leisurely stroll, enjoy a picnic, or simply soak in the stunning scenery, this park has something for everyone. The park is designed not only for relaxation but also for recreation. Families can enjoy various activities, including open play areas and interactive water features, while the surrounding boardwalk invites visitors to explore local shops and eateries. The vibrant atmosphere is often complemented by community events, art installations, and live performances, making it a cultural hub as well as a green space. Visitors can also take advantage of the nearby attractions, such as the iconic Seattle Great Wheel and the bustling Pike Place Market, both just a short walk away.
